>> As for the content of the patch, my only question is why do you add an
>> optional maintain-point argument to `org-babel-tangle-jump-to-org'?  Is
>> there ever a case when you would not want to maintain the point?
>>
>> Of much less importance I have a couple of stylistic notes about the
>> code which are largely unrelated to its functionality and are included
>> to make future changes easier to read and because I'm a cranky old lisp
>> programmer.
>>
>> - you should indent the code s.t. no lines are longer than 79 characters
>> - comments which float after code (e.g., ";; end of first delimiter")
>>   should only use 1 ; character
>> - the series of if statements (if should-be-padded... if
>>   possibly-padded... if actually-padded...) would be more legible if
>>   written as a single `cond' form.
>>
>> Thanks for this change.  It appears to pass all tests, so after the
>> above have been addressed I'd be very happy to apply it.

From cce0cf9682c01c8ff4d36d0bf06df223b7c7cb6e Mon Sep 17 00:00:00 2001
From: Aditya Siram <aditya siram at gmail dot com>
Date: Fri, 13 Sep 2013 09:57:25 -0500
Subject: [PATCH 1/2] org-babel-src-block-regexp ignores empty body

 org-babel-src-block gobbled up everything until the ending delimiter
 of the next code block. Fixed this by making the body regexp non-greedy.

 lisp/ob-core.el | 2 +
 1 file changed, 1 insertion(+), 1 deletion(-)
---
 lisp/ob-core.el | 2 +-
 1 file changed, 1 insertion(+), 1 deletion(-)

diff --git a/lisp/ob-core.el b/lisp/ob-core.el
index d57806b..e8f16a0 100644
--- a/lisp/ob-core.el
+++ b/lisp/ob-core.el
@@ -188,7 +188,7 @@ This string must include a \"%s\" which will be replaced by 
the results."
    ;; (4) header arguments
    "\\([^\n]*\\)\n"
    ;; (5) body
-   "\\([^\000]*?\n\\)?[ \t]*#\\+end_src")
+   "\\([^\000]*?\n\\)??[ \t]*#\\+end_src")
   "Regexp used to identify code blocks.")
